Subject[PATCH] sched: fix the calculation of __sched_period in sched_slice()
Date
When we get the sched_slice of a sched_entity, we use cfs_rq->nr_running
to calculate the whole __sched_period. But cfs_rq->nr_running is the
number of sched_entity in that cfs_rq, rq->nr_running is the number
of all the tasks that are not throttled. So we should use the
rq->nr_running to calculate the whole __sched_period value.
